The Environmental Effect of E-Waste

The surge in electronic device usage has released a mounting challenge: e-waste. This waste constitutes discarded electronics that contain hazardous materials, including lead, mercury, and cadmium. When disposed of carelessly, these substances can leach into soil and water systems, posing severe risks to human health and ecosystems. The buildup in landfills exacerbates these issues, as the breakdown of electronic components releases toxic chemicals into the environment. Additionally, e-waste causes resource depletion; valuable metals like gold and copper are often lost rather than recycled. In many regions, poor management practices for e-waste further complicate the situation, leading to increased pollution and habitat destruction. As the demand for new technology continues to rise, the environmental impact of e-waste becomes a pressing concern, calling for urgent action to mitigate its effects and promote sustainable practices in electronics disposal.

Classify E-Waste Segments

E-waste encompasses a wide range of obsolete electronic devices that pose risks to the environment if not handled correctly. Common types of e-waste include computers, laptops, smartphones, tablets, televisions, and printers. Household appliances such as microwaves, refrigerators, and air conditioners also fall under this group. Additionally, smaller electronics like gaming consoles, chargers, and batteries contribute to the increasing e-waste issue. Each of these items holds harmful materials, including heavy metals and toxic substances, which can seep into the soil and water if discarded improperly. Recognizing these types of e-waste is essential for proper disposal, making sure that individuals and organizations can take appropriate steps towards sustainable recycling and environmental protection. Proper identification is the initial stage in responsible e-waste management.

How to Select the Best Electronics Recycling Program?

When reviewing the finest electronics waste management initiative, individuals should emphasize sustainability and compliance with local regulations. A trusted program will adhere to professional guidelines, guaranteeing that hazardous materials are managed securely and conscientiously.

Furthermore, people should examine the program's credentials, such as R2 (Responsible Recycling) or e-Stewards, which demonstrate compliance with strict environmental and ethical guidelines. Openness is also essential; programs should clearly outline their recycling processes and provide information on how materials are reused or disposed of.

Analyzing customer reviews and testimonials can deliver deep understanding into the program's stability and effectualness. Also, availability and comfort are significant factors; individuals should choose a program that is accessible and provides a variety of drop-off or pick-up options. In conclusion, choosing the right electronics recycling program supports not only sustainability efforts but also assures compliance with local laws and regulations.

Conservation Resource Impact

Resource conservation stands out as an essential advantage of recycling electronics, greatly cutting down the extraction of raw materials. By reprocessing old devices, valuable metals such as gold, silver, and copper can be recovered and reused, decreasing the demand for new resource extraction. This process not only protects natural habitats but also minimizes energy consumption associated with mining and refining. Additionally, recycling electronics mitigates the environmental impact of waste disposal, as discarded devices often contain hazardous substances. By encouraging the reuse of materials, recycling fosters a circular economy, where resources are continually repurposed rather than discarded. Ultimately, the practice of recycling electronics plays a pivotal role in sustainable resource management, making sure that future generations can access essential materials without exhausting the planet’s resources.

May I Recycle Electronics Without Removing Personal Data First?

Discarding electronic equipment without erasing confidential information is not advisable. Sensitive information could be exposed by bad actors, leading to data leaks. Responsible disposal encompasses secure data removal or physical destruction to guarantee personal information remains secure.

How Are My Tech Items Handled After Recycling?

After recycling, machines are dismantled, with valuable materials extracted for recycling into new products. Hazardous components are safely processed, warding off nature damage. Ultimately, recycling guarantees proper waste handling, safeguarding resources and minimizing landfill contributions while promoting sustainability.

Are There Charges for Recycling Electronics?

Prices for electronic waste management can fluctuate by location and organization. Some facilities deliver free services, while others may request a small fee, especially for larger items or specific types of electronic waste.
